Virtual Field Trip - Wed., Oct. 17th

http://www.discoveryeducation.com//Live/mos.cfm

A Virtual Field Trip from the Museum of Science October 17, 2013 1:00-2:00 PM ET Live from Museum of Science in Boston, MA
This event will explore the natural and human-made world through the lens of engineering. We'll be visiting STEMtastic exhibits like a Van de Graaff generator, a machine that makes musical thunder and lightning. We will also get a sneak peak of the Hall of Human Life, a brand-new exhibit opening in November. Its role is to highlight breakthroughs in biology and biotechnology.
Students will have an opportunity to submit questions beforehand.
